Summer
is the busiest season with holidaying Europeans
so it may not be the best time to visit
if you want a quiet holiday. However during
off-season periods many hotels and restaurants
and other tourist services can close down,
although prices are generally lower for
what is open. Generally the best time to
visit is from April to June and September
to October when weather is good, prices
are lower and there are less tourists.
Generally spring is the best time to visit
France although relapses from the winter
are not unknown. Autumn is also a pleasant
time. If winter sports are your thing winter
in the Alps and Pyrenees are great. Christmas,
New Year and February/March school holidays
are expensive times here. Paris has a wet
winter but stages all sorts of cultural
shows.
